Open regedit, by going to Start -> Run -> type regedit and press Enter. Navigate to H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\ShellNoRoam. Right-click on the ShellNoRoam key, choose Export and save the file (This backs-up the current settings. To be extra safe create a system restore point). Delete the two keys below. Reboot and re-set your folder options.
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\ShellNoRoam\BagMRU
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\ShellNoRoam\Bags

Up to XP SP2 Explorer will only remember 200 local folder settings. With XP SP2 it will remember 5000 settings. By deleting the reg keys I mentioned in the earlier post you'll reset the views and the view count. More information is available here:
